About the role
Viatec Traffic Solutions is part of the Paneltec Group, a 100% Tasmanian-owned and operated business.
We provide comprehensive traffic management services across Tasmania, including traffic planning and design, permit applications, safety and risk analysis, and the implementation of traffic management solutions.
Due to continued growth, we are seeking a qualified and experienced Traffic Management Designer to join our team at our Kings Meadows depot.
Reporting to the Traffic Manager, you will play an important role in supporting our operational teams and contributing to Viatec’s ongoing success as a leading provider of traffic management services in Tasmania.
As a Traffic Management Designer, your responsibilities will include:
Developing Traffic Guidance Schemes (TGS) and Traffic Management Plans (TMP) in accordance with applicable legislation, standards, guidelines and approval requirements.
Conducting risk assessments and hazard identification to maintain high safety standards.
Preparing, submitting and managing permit applications and approvals.
Communicating Traffic Management Plans and Traffic Guidance Schemes to operational teams.
Liaising with local councils, government agencies, road authorities, clients and other stakeholders to obtain necessary approvals.
Providing technical advice and support to internal teams and clients regarding traffic management requirements and industry best practice.
Assisting with site inspections and compliance audits against approved Traffic Management Plans.
Maintaining accurate records relating to plans, permits, approvals and risk assessments.
Attending pre-start meetings and providing traffic management guidance when required.
Managing multiple projects and ensuring designs and applications are completed within required timeframes.
To be successful in this role, you will ideally have:
A current driver’s licence.
A current Construction Industry White Card.
Experience preparing Traffic Management Plans and Traffic Guidance Schemes.
Proficiency in traffic management planning and design software.
A sound understanding of workplace health and safety systems, risk management and traffic management procedures.
Strong written and verbal communication skills.
The ability to manage multiple tasks, competing priorities and deadlines.
Strong problem-solving skills and a proactive, practical approach.
Previous experience working with local councils, road authorities, government agencies or civil construction contractors.
Experience conducting traffic management site inspections or compliance audits.
